Goodwill of Middle Tennessee offers home pickup of donations through appointments.

House 2 Home brings hope by turning empty rooms into homes: providing new beds and gently used furnishings to recently homeless people. They accept gently used furniture and household items.

Junkdrop Nashville offers a lovely way to get rid of some of the junk piling up in your home. This service, which charges varying flat fees depending on whether they’re picking up furniture or helping you with a full clean out, doesn’t just take the stuff out of your house–it also helps sort and deliver it to folks in need at nonprofits across the city. For example, some of the folks who sell Nashville’s street newspaper, The Contributor, benefit from Junkdrop when they get into housing. The service also offers a number of tips for recycling and reusing items on its website.

The Salvation Army provides donation pickups. Call to schedule.

ThriftSmart offers donation pick-up service and area drop off locations.
